Neuropathy, or nerve damage, can vary widely in its course and prognosis. In some cases, particularly those caused by conditions like Diabetes or vitamin deficiencies, addressing the underlying cause can lead to significant improvement or even resolution of symptoms. However, in other instances, neuropathy may be chronic and persist despite treatment. Management often focuses on alleviating symptoms and improving quality of life rather than achieving a complete cure.
